About the Book:
Amanullah: Ex-King of Afghanistan by Roland Wild chronicles the dramatic life and political journey of Amanullah Khan, one of the most significant reformist rulers in modern Afghan history. The book traces Amanullah Khan’s rise to power, his ambitious modernization efforts, and his attempts to transform Afghanistan through political, social, and educational reforms during the early twentieth century. It also explores the resistance his reforms generated, the political upheavals that followed, and his eventual exile. Through historical narrative and biographical insight, Roland Wild presents a vivid portrait of a visionary yet controversial monarch navigating a turbulent period in Afghanistan’s history.
